witch hazel plant

Definitions of witch hazel plant
  1. noun
    any of several shrubs or trees of the genus Hamamelis; bark yields an astringent lotion

    types:
    Hamamelis virginiana, Virginian witch hazel
    common shrub of eastern North America having small yellow flowers after the leaves have fallen
    Hamamelis vernalis, vernal witch hazel
    fragrant shrub of lower Mississippi valley having very small flowers from midwinter to spring
    type of:
    bush, shrub
    a low woody perennial plant usually having several major stems
